Core Components of Effective Performance Management

A robust Performance Management Activities Pdf integrates several key elements that drive impactful results. First is goal alignment—linking individual contributions directly to departmental objectives and organizational vision. When employees understand how their work supports broader missions, engagement naturally increases. Next is ongoing feedback; regular check-ins replace outdated annual assessments with timely insights that drive real-time improvement. Continuous coaching plays an equally vital role. Rather than waiting for formal reviews, managers guide team members through ongoing conversations that build confidence and clarify priorities. This culture of open dialogue cultivates psychological safety, encouraging honesty about challenges without fear of reprisal. Additionally, data-driven decision-making strengthens the process by grounding evaluations in measurable metrics—productivity rates, project completion timelines, quality benchmarks—ensuring fairness and precision. Training and development must be seamlessly woven into the framework. Identifying skill deficiencies through assessments or performance gaps allows organizations to design tailored learning paths embedded within the PDF system. Whether through workshops, e-learning modules, or mentorship programs, these interventions turn weaknesses into strengths systematically.
